M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
addresses
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
evolvements in
blended learning technology have empowered
learners
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OCs are
almost always free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
issues that
online learning organizations
have to deal with
now that e-learning technology is
advancing so quickly.
How can participants
certify that
the quality of training provided by these
massively open online courses is
satisfactory?
How can stakeholders
make sure that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ach MOOC classes?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
Stanford University to conduct these MOOC courses?
What assessment strategies and original teaching practices are optimal?
How can participants
handle problems like
inadequate
motivation and high
learner attrition?
